Transaction 952ed016ac571d0132f8959348d6b4bc53ffc9500e89be53a6d3e6d461a6103a

1 Input
2 Outputs
  • 952ed016ac571d0132f8959348d6b4bc53ffc9500e89be53a6d3e6d461a6103a:0
  • value  2000000
    address  1dice9wcMu5hLF4g81u8nioL5mmSHTApw
  • 952ed016ac571d0132f8959348d6b4bc53ffc9500e89be53a6d3e6d461a6103a:1
  • value  16951814
    address  1CuxL3AnDofqgJ46tx1ZNHDoeJhRJPD8nx